Use the FOIL (first, outside, inside, last) to expand the terms in the brackets.
(w - 7)(w + 4)
first: w × w = w²
outside: w × 4 = 4w
inside: -7 × w = -7w
last: -7 × 4 = -28
Now you add all the terms together to get:
w² + 4w - 7w - 28
This simplifies to give you:
w² - 3w - 28

This method of solving quadratic equation is used when there is only x² term and no x term. Thus;
For example, we have a quadratic equation;
x² - 1 = 80
To solve this by square root method, the first step we have to take is to isolate the x² term by inverse operation which is by addition of 1 to both sides to get rid of the -1 on the left side so that x² can be isolated.
